Abstract
The theory of singular dislocations is placed within the framework of the theory of continuous dislocations using de Rham currents. For a general n-dimensional manifold, an (n – 1)-current describes a local layering structure and its boundary in the sense of currents represents the structure of the dislocations. Frank’s rules for dislocations follow naturally from the nilpotency of the boundary operator.
